How UK Online Casinos Operate

Unlike the old-school brick-and-mortar venues where you can size up the dealer and the crowd, online casinos rely heavily on software algorithms and random number generators (RNGs) to keep things unpredictable. This digital roulette wheel spins without human intervention, which can be both reassuring and unnerving depending on your trust in technology.

Licensing and Regulation

The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is the watchdog that keeps the online casino operators in check. Without a UKGC license, an online casino is basically a wild west saloon—anything goes, and the house might not play fair. Licensed operators must adhere to strict rules on fairness, player protection, and responsible gambling.

What to Watch Out For

Before you get starry-eyed over a new casino, consider the fine print. Wagering requirements, withdrawal limits, and bonus restrictions can turn a seemingly generous offer into a trap. It’s like being handed a golden ticket that only works if you jump through flaming hoops first.

  • Check the payout percentages (RTP) of games you want to play.
  • Read the terms and conditions carefully, especially regarding bonuses.
  • Verify the casino’s licensing and regulatory status.
  • Look for transparent customer support options.
  • Be wary of casinos with unclear or missing information.

Responsible Gambling: The Elephant in the Room

Let’s face it, gambling can be addictive, and the online format makes it easier to lose track of time and money. The industry has made strides in promoting responsible gambling, but it’s still up to the player to set limits and recognize when the fun stops. Tools like self-exclusion, deposit limits, and reality checks are there for a reason—use them before you find yourself wishing you had.

Setting Your Own Boundaries

Think of responsible gambling like knowing when to fold in poker. It’s not about quitting cold turkey but about making smart decisions that keep the game enjoyable. If you’re chasing losses or betting more than you can afford, it’s time to step back and reassess.
